Small Business Cybersecurity Guide for Real Risks
A fraudulent invoice does not need to look sophisticated to cause real damage. It may arrive in the inbox of an office manager who is processing payments between calls, or a manager who recognizes a supplier name and clicks before checking the sender address. One wrong click can expose accounts, interrupt operations, and turn a normal workday into a costly recovery effort.
This small business cybersecurity guide focuses on the controls that make the biggest practical difference: reducing easy entry points, protecting critical data, and ensuring your team can keep working if an attack gets through. The goal is not to turn every employee into an IT specialist. It is to build sensible layers of protection around the systems your business relies on.
Start With the Risks That Can Stop Your Business
Small businesses are often targeted because attackers expect limited internal IT resources, inconsistent security settings, and busy employees who have little time to investigate suspicious messages. Ransomware, credential theft, payment fraud, and unauthorized access are not problems reserved for large companies.
The risk is not just the attack itself. It is the disruption that follows. Can your staff access customer records if the server is unavailable? Can you restore files after ransomware? Would a compromised email account let someone redirect payments or impersonate a company leader?
A useful first step is identifying what needs protection most. For many organizations, that includes email, financial systems, customer data, shared files, line-of-business software, phones, internet connections, and cloud accounts. Then consider the consequences if each system is unavailable, altered, or accessed by the wrong person.
This assessment does not need to be a long technical exercise. It should give you a clear view of priorities, where gaps exist, and which improvements are worth funding first.
Build a Small Business Cybersecurity Foundation
Cybersecurity works best in layers. A firewall matters, but it cannot prevent an employee from giving away a password. Multi-factor authentication helps protect accounts, but it does not replace reliable backups. The right setup combines technology, policies, and support that fit how your business actually operates.
Protect Accounts Before They Are Misused
Email and cloud accounts are often the front door to a business. If an attacker gains access to one account, they may reset passwords elsewhere, search mailboxes for banking details, send convincing requests to coworkers, or access shared documents.
Require multi-factor authentication for email, financial applications, remote access, cloud storage, and administrator accounts. A password alone is no longer enough, even if it is long and unique. Use a password manager to help staff create and store different passwords for every account rather than reusing familiar credentials.
Also review who has access. Former employees, temporary contractors, and old shared accounts create unnecessary exposure. Access should match a person’s role, and it should be removed promptly when that role changes.
Treat Email as a Primary Security Concern
Most small business attacks still begin with email. Phishing messages can imitate vendors, delivery services, banks, executives, or internal departments. They often create urgency: an overdue invoice, a changed banking instruction, a password expiration notice, or a file that needs immediate review.
Email filtering can block a large volume of malicious messages before they reach users, but no filter catches everything. Employees need a simple reporting process and clear permission to pause before acting. A good rule is to verify unexpected requests involving payments, passwords, sensitive files, or account changes through a second channel, such as a known phone number.
For payment-related requests, establish a written verification step. If a vendor asks to change bank details, do not rely on the email thread alone. Call a verified contact. That small process change can prevent a major loss.
Keep Devices and Networks Maintained
Unpatched computers, servers, firewalls, and applications are common entry points. Updates can feel disruptive, particularly when operations depend on older software or specialized equipment. Still, delaying every update leaves known weaknesses open longer than necessary.
Set a predictable patching process. Standard updates can often be installed automatically or during planned maintenance windows, while major updates should be tested and scheduled with business needs in mind. It depends on your environment, but the key is to make patching a managed routine rather than an occasional reaction.
Endpoint protection should be installed and monitored on workstations and servers. A properly configured business firewall, secure Wi-Fi, and separate guest access also help limit exposure. Remote workers should use approved devices, secure connections, and the same account protections as employees in the office.
Backups Are Your Recovery Plan
A backup is only valuable if it can be restored when you need it. Businesses sometimes discover too late that their backup was incomplete, inaccessible, or connected to the same network ransomware encrypted.
Use a backup approach that keeps multiple copies of important data, including at least one copy stored separately from your main environment. Off-site or cloud backup can protect against theft, fire, hardware failure, and local ransomware events. For critical systems, consider an immutable or otherwise protected backup that attackers cannot easily alter or delete.
Just as important, test restoration. Recover a file, a folder, and, where appropriate, a full system. Testing shows whether backups are complete and whether your team knows how long recovery will take. A daily backup that takes several days to restore may not meet the needs of a business that depends on immediate access to its systems.
Your recovery plan should answer practical questions: who calls your IT provider, how employees communicate if email is down, where staff can access emergency contacts, and which systems must be restored first. This is business continuity, not just data storage.
Give Employees Clear, Repeatable Guidance
Security awareness training should be short, relevant, and ongoing. A once-a-year presentation is easy to forget. Brief reminders, simulated phishing exercises, and clear policies tend to work better because they reinforce decisions employees make every day.
Focus training on real situations: recognizing suspicious links, handling unexpected attachments, reporting a lost device, approving payment changes, and responding to multi-factor authentication prompts they did not initiate. Employees should know that reporting a suspicious email is helpful, even if it turns out to be harmless.
Avoid a blame-based approach. People are more likely to report mistakes quickly when they know the priority is limiting damage, not assigning fault. Early reporting can be the difference between resetting one account and containing a wider breach.
Know What to Do When Something Goes Wrong
No security plan guarantees that an incident will never happen. The practical objective is to detect issues quickly, contain them, and restore operations with as little disruption as possible.
Create a straightforward incident response process before an emergency occurs. Staff should know whom to contact if they see a suspicious login, a ransomware message, a missing device, or an email sent from their account without permission. Your IT team or managed service provider should be able to investigate, isolate affected devices, secure accounts, and guide recovery.
Do not let an employee attempt to solve a suspected attack alone. Disconnecting a compromised computer from the network may be appropriate, but deleting files, rebooting repeatedly, or communicating with an attacker can complicate investigation and recovery. A coordinated response protects evidence and reduces the chance that an incident spreads.
Depending on the type of data involved, a cyber incident may also create reporting, insurance, contractual, or legal obligations. Your response plan should identify the people who need to be involved, including leadership, IT support, insurance contacts, and legal or compliance advisors when necessary.
